Overview
The Rattlesnake is an uncommon pet in Adopt Me!, introduced on January 25, 2024. It boasts a captivating design with a brown body, light brown underbelly, and striking triangular details across its form.
When released, the Rattlesnake was available through the Desert Egg, offering a unique chance for players to add this slithery companion to their collection. Its bright yellow rattle and flickering red forked tongue make it stand out.
Although no longer obtainable from eggs, players can still get their hands on a Rattlesnake by hatching any remaining Desert or Royal Desert Eggs, or by trading with other players.

Neon & Mega Neon
The Neon Rattlesnake features glowing orange highlights on its eye markings, body patterns, tongue, and rattle, adding a vibrant look to its appearance.
For the Mega Neon version, these areas cycle through the colors of the rainbow, creating a mesmerizing display. To create a Neon Rattlesnake, you'll need four Full Grown Rattlesnakes, and for a Mega Neon, four Full Grown Neon Rattlesnakes.
